Ann Arbor, MI-based multi-instrumentalist/writer Thomas Meluch -- who uses Benoet Pioulard as one of his musical alter egos -- combines found sounds, electronics, and atmospheric rock and pop in his various projects. A part of the Rattling Wall Collective in Dutch, a loose-knit group of likeminded musicians, Meluch also collaborated on a multimedia piece for the University of Michigan's 2003 Film and Video Studies Association Lightworks Festival. Precis is the first album from Thomas Meluch under his musical pseudonym Benoit Pioulard. Following a series of limited, handmade cassette and CDR releases for friends and family over the last several years, and the well-received Enge EP, Precis arose as a documentation of a coming to terms with impermanence, marked by analog residue and the imperfections of human influence. VINYL FORMAT. Two new long tracks on a 33rpm 7". "Maginot" features gorgeous vocals and acoustic guitar. "Alaskan Lashes" is a smear of found sounds and ambient tones. Housed in a heavy card sleeve, a mini LP style sleeve, complete with title on the spine. Pressed on very pretty, pale yellow vinyl. Limited to 500 copies!

Temper is the second album by Thomas Meluch under his Benoit Pioulard nom de guerre. Composed throughout a year that involved graduation from university and a cross-continental relocation, its 16 tracks arose in specific periods of intense creative energy. Assembling various analog sources on basic software at home, Pioulard has honed his craft into a form that suggests something far grander.
